Q: Is 134,110,434 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 134,110,434 is a composite number.

Why is 134,110,434 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 134,110,434 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 6 113 226 339 678 197,803 395,606 593,409 1,186,818 22,351,739 44,703,478 67,055,217 and 134,110,434, with no remainder.

Since 134,110,434 cannot be divided by just 1 and 134,110,434, it is a composite number.
